eInfochips vs HCLTech: overview

eInfochips

eInfochips was founded in 1994 in Ahmedabad, India and has grown into a large product engineering firm, now operating as an Arrow Electronics company following Arrow's acquisition. For an RFP requiring component sourcing alongside engineering, the Arrow Electronics parent relationship is a genuine differentiator — direct supply-chain access most independent embedded vendors cannot offer. The firm's engagement models span fixed project, dedicated team, and staff augmentation, and design centers across India, Japan, and the US support round-the-clock delivery documentation for globally distributed procurement programs.

HCLTech

HCLTech was founded in 1976 and is headquartered in Noida, India, with a global workforce exceeding 227,000 employees. Engineering and R&D Services (ERS) is one of three major HCLTech business units, offering embedded engineering with stated strength in safety-critical systems, semiconductor engineering, and 5G platform engineering. For a procurement team, HCLTech's relevant leverage is existing relationships — the company states it works with more than 100 of the top 250 global R&D spenders — but RFP evaluators should confirm which specific ERS team and track record would actually be assigned before treating company-wide scale as a proxy for embedded-specific delivery capability.

eInfochips vs HCLTech: pros and cons

eInfochips
+ Arrow Electronics ownership gives direct component-sourcing access, useful for RFPs that bundle supply-chain risk into the scope of work
+ 30-year product engineering history with 500+ documented deliveries supports strong reference-checking
+ Design centers across India, Japan, and the US support round-the-clock delivery documentation for global procurement programs
- Owned by Arrow Electronics — embedded engineering is one line of business inside a much larger distribution company; confirm dedicated team continuity
- Public pricing and minimum engagement figures are not disclosed
- Reported team size estimates vary significantly by source, making exact capacity harder to pin down for RFP scoring
HCLTech
+ Unmatched global scale (227,000+ employees company-wide) supports the largest and most complex multi-domain RFP programs
+ Dedicated Engineering & R&D Services business unit with stated safety-critical and semiconductor engineering capability
+ Existing relationships with more than 100 of the top 250 global R&D spenders provide a checkable scale signal
- Embedded engineering is one capability within one of three major HCLTech business units — confirm which specific ERS team and track record applies before scoring
- Scale and process overhead of a 227,000-person company is a poor fit for small, fast-moving RFP lots
- No public pricing, minimum engagement, or ERS-specific headcount figures disclosed separately from the whole company
